Compare all specifications:

1964 Austin Princess 1969 Ford Capri
Make Austin Ford
Model Princess Capri
Year Released 1964 1969
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3993 cc 2548 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 119 HP 142 HP
Engine RPM 4000 RPM 5500 RPM
Torque 251 Nm 221 Nm
Torque RPM 2000 RPM 3100 RPM
Engine Compression Ratio 8.5:1 9.0:1
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Doors 2 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 2180 kg 1044 kg
Vehicle Length 5470 mm 4270 mm
Vehicle Width 1900 mm 1650 mm
Vehicle Height 1780 mm 1340 mm
Wheelbase Size 3360 mm 2570 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 72 L 68 L
